|
@@ -156,6 +156,7 @@
|
|
|
#include <linux/spinlock.h>
|
|
|
#include <linux/gameport.h>
|
|
|
#include <linux/wait.h>
|
|
|
+#include <linux/dma-mapping.h>
|
|
|
|
|
|
#include <asm/io.h>
|
|
|
#include <asm/page.h>
|
|
@@ -2569,7 +2570,7 @@ static int __devinit es1370_probe(struct pci_dev *pcidev, const struct pci_devic
|
|
|
return -ENODEV;
|
|
|
if (pcidev->irq == 0)
|
|
|
return -ENODEV;
|
|
|
- i = pci_set_dma_mask(pcidev, 0xffffffff);
|
|
|
+ i = pci_set_dma_mask(pcidev, DMA_32BIT_MASK);
|
|
|
if (i) {
|
|
|
printk(KERN_WARNING "es1370: architecture does not support 32bit PCI busmaster DMA\n");
|
|
|
return i;
|